This is a study to build up a technical procedure for taking gastric juice via gastroscope and measuring pH on 438 patients with gastro-duodenal erosion or ulcer at Bac Giang General Hospital. Results: the technique of taking gastric juice by leading the tip of gastroscope in the “liquid puddle” and then sucking gastric juice through biopsy canal by a syringe of 100ml had been 94.6% successful; this technique is simple and easy to do. Measuring pH of gastric juice on 363 patients with gastro-duodenal erosion or ulcer found no patient with pH<1; over 80% of them were found with gastric juice pH 1 to 3; pH of gastric juice has no relation with age and sex
